The first step is understanding your motivations. Do you reach for the game to relieve stress, or are you trying to recover what you’ve lost?
Recognizing the emotional trigger behind each session helps set healthier boundaries before you even sit down to play. Understanding your inner drive lets you establish limits before the screen lights up
Setting limits is crucial, and it’s best to do so before you begin. Before you even click "play," determine your cap on time and cash, and treat it as sacred
Treat your gaming budget like any other entertainment expense—something you’ve allocated for fun, not a source of income or a way to solve financial stress. This isn’t your emergency fund, your rent money, or a path out of debt—it’s recreation, pure and simple
Many platforms offer tools to help with this, such as daily or weekly deposit caps, session timers, and self-exclusion options. You’re not alone: platforms have created tools like time trackers, deposit freezes, and cooling-off periods to keep players grounded
Take advantage of them; they exist not to restrict you, but to protect you from impulsive decisions made in the heat of the moment. These features aren’t censorship—they’re compassion built into code
It’s also important to maintain balance in your life. Keep your world whole: sleep, work, movement, and connection must stay untouched by the game
If you find yourself skipping meals, losing track of hours, or lying about how much you’ve spent, those are red flags. Lying about time, money, or habits? That’s not a habit—it’s a cry for help
Reach out to friends or family you trust and be honest about your habits. Don’t isolate—find a safe person and say out loud what you’ve been hiding
Sometimes, just speaking aloud what you’re experiencing can bring clarity and accountability. The moment you name your struggle, you begin to reclaim your power
Pay attention to how you feel after playing. Your emotional residue is the truest indicator of whether this activity serves you
The emotional aftermath often reveals more than the outcome of the game itself. If your inner state is worse than when you started, the game has cost you more than money
If negative feelings consistently follow your sessions, it’s worth reconsidering your relationship with the activity. When anxiety, guilt, or emptiness become your regular companions after playing, it’s time to pause and reflect
